-ings-fase '-ings' is a nominalizing suffix (Old Norse origin). '-fase' is borrowed from French via Danish/Norwegian.

The word 'undersøkingsfase' is a Norwegian Nynorsk compound noun divided into six syllables: un-der-sø-kings-fa-se. The primary stress falls on 'sø'. It consists of the prefix 'under-', the root 'søke', and the suffixes '-ings' and '-fase'. Syllabification follows onset maximization and vowel peak principles.
